Famous race car Lightning McQueen is on his way to California to compete against The King and Chick Hicks for the Piston Cup when he accidentally damages the roads of a small town called Radiator Springs. Moreover, he needs to work hard to repair himself as well. During this time, he forms friendships and experiences true love while spending time in that town. His values begin to change as he stays in this small town. Only then will he be ready to become a true winner.

Overview

The 2006 film "Cars" is a family comedy directed by the renowned animation director John Lasseter. Featuring the voices of successful talents like Owen Wilson, Paul Newman, Bonnie Hunt, Larry the Cable Guy, and Cheech Marin, this film offers viewers both an entertaining and emotional journey. This animated feature promises a delightful viewing experience for both children and adults.

At the center of "Cars" is the story of the famous race car Lightning McQueen. On his way to California to win the Piston Cup, McQueen ends up in a small town called Radiator Springs due to an accident. This town becomes not just a stop for him, but also a place where he will learn some of life's most important lessons. During his time there, McQueen forms friendships, experiences true love, and discovers the meaning of life. In this process, he learns to look beyond his own ambitions and realizes what it means to be a true winner.

John Lasseter is recognized as a significant director in the animation world, and he skillfully showcases this talent in "Cars." The film stands out with its visually impressive scenes and smooth storytelling. The color palette and detailed character designs used by Lasseter help viewers connect even more with the film. The voice performances are also quite remarkable; Owen Wilson’s portrayal of McQueen brings both comedic and emotional moments to the audience. Paul Newman’s character Doc Hudson adds significant emotional depth to the story.

The importance of "Cars" lies not only in being an entertaining animation but also in addressing universal themes such as friendship, love, and sacrifice. The film emphasizes the importance of sharing and being together alongside ambition. For those looking for a family-friendly film, "Cars" might just be the perfect choice. With its fun scenes and touching moments, this film both entertains and provokes thought.
